Seen this type of cooking challenges before, but never with a fairytale setting. That's fresh at least!

Let's start with the positives. The visuals are clean, cute and bright. The only little niggle I have with the graphics is that there are three background textures (grey, wood, white) and that is one too many. Maybe get rid of the wooden one. It does not fit in with the other flat colored assets.

I do have bigger issues to point out though. First there's the GUI. It is very busy! You tried to cram everything on to the screen at the same time, which sometimes is a good idea sure, but here certain things are left outside of the screen anyways so… It doesn't exactly work out.

The mouse controls are cumbersome, having to scroll from left to right all the time. The usage of the varying machines is not very clear either. Especially the mixing pot, which does not, in any way, indicate that it has to be pressed again for the broth to not boil over.

Lastly, there is currently no challenge apart from figuring out the GUI. Usually these cooking challenges allow the cook player to do multiple things at the same time by, say, leaving a brew to boil, while cutting cucumbers and heating up ovens. This way the player needs to keep tabs on many concurrent activities, make choices and avoid mistakes. Here everything is always done in order, consecutively, no multitasking, no risk, no danger, no challenge.

Ok, some suggestions then. I would only show the recipes when next to the cabin, freeing up a lot of space for fancy background graphics and clearing the frame. The princess could move with the keyboard, ridding the GUI of the scrolling buttons. Each activity should have a reaction based challenge and a risk attached. For instance, washing is easy, but if you miss the prompt, due to rushing, it takes twice as long instead; failing an enchantment could transform an ingredient into another; cutting your own finger requires a trip to a medcabin costing time; even the hair growing mystery machine could have a possible downside if used hastily.
